"Domestic Partners" Sen. Joe Lieberman, D-Conn., moved to shore up the Democratic voter base this week when he formally endorsed domes- tic partner benefits for government workers. Speaking to a Reform Jewish group, the Democratic presidential candidate expressed concern about gay and lesbian couples who "have . formed long-term committed relationships but who still are discriminated against when they dis- cover that they can't visit their partner in a hospital or can't receive health care benefits or enjoy other crucial rights and responsibilities." He then promised to work on behalf of stalled legislation sponsored by Sen. Mark Dayton, D-Minn., and the late Sen. Paul Wellstone, D-Minn., "to extend to the domestic partners of all federal employees the same ben- efits and obligations that are afforded the spouses Sen. of their fellow employ- Lieberman ees." And he promised that if the bill fails, "I intend to introduce it and sign it as president of the United States." That is consistent with Lieberman's past positions, but it is also an attempt by the candidate — seen as "too conser- vative" by some Democrats — to shore up his position with the party base before the primaries, said the University of Virginia's Larry Sabato. "The senator is trying to emphasize those parts of his record to appeal to the activists that will show up in the Democratic caucuses and primaries around the country," Sabato said. "If he's nominated, of course, he'll quickly shift back to the more conservative themes." But the move could prove risky. "His problem will be that this endorsement of gay rights will be on the record, available for the Republicans' use in the fall," Sabato said. Lieberman's comments were quickly condemned by Orthodox Jewish groups. "We have long opposed any government recognition of a marriage-like relation- ship among domestic partners, whether they be gay domestic partners or straight domestic partners," said Abba Cohen of Agudath Israel of America.
